Responsibilities of a Voters’ Roll Officer

Voters’ Roll Officers have a multifaceted role that ensures the electoral process runs smoothly and fairly.

Registration and Data Management

  • Managing voter registration is a primary duty. This involves compiling and organizing voter data securely.
  • Data accuracy is paramount, and officers must ensure all voter details are correctly entered.

Verification and Updates

  • Verification processes are routinely conducted to cross-check and validate the information on the roll.
  • Officers must accommodate ongoing changes such as address updates or registrations that could affect voter eligibility.

Collaboration and Communication

  • Working with various stakeholders including governmental bodies, other electoral staff, and the general public is crucial.
  • They often act as a bridge, facilitating effective communication and addressing public queries or concerns.

Importance of Their Role

Ensuring election integrity is one of the more crucial aspects of a Voters’ Roll Officer’s work. A precise and updated voters’ roll reduces the risk of electoral fraud and increases public trust in the electoral system. Furthermore, their role is integral to the democratic process, ensuring that every eligible voter can exercise their right.

Challenges Faced by Voters’ Roll Officers

Despite their essential role, Voters’ Roll Officers face various challenges:

  • Handling large volumes of data while maintaining accuracy.
  • Dealing with rapidly changing voter information.
  • Ensuring compliance with electoral laws and regulations.

Officers often need to rely on technology and coordination with other agencies to overcome these challenges.

FAQs

1. What is a Voters’ Roll Officer?
A Voters’ Roll Officer is responsible for the accurate and fair compilation, updating, and maintenance of the electoral register.

2. Why is the accuracy of the voters’ roll crucial?
Accuracy ensures all eligible voters can participate in elections and mitigates fraudulent activities.

3. How do Voters’ Roll Officers update voter information?
Through regular verification processes, accepting public applications for updates, and collaborating with relevant agencies.

4. What skills are essential for a Voters’ Roll Officer?
Attention to detail, data management skills, communication, and understanding of electoral laws.

5. Can the public access the voters’ roll?
Typically, it’s accessible under strict conditions to maintain privacy and security, often during specified periods before elections.
